Flutter Engine
The Flutter Engine
Namespaces | Functions | Variables
process.cc File Reference
#include "bin/process.h"
#include "bin/dartutils.h"
#include "bin/io_buffer.h"
#include "bin/namespace.h"
#include "bin/platform.h"
#include "bin/socket.h"
#include "bin/utils.h"
#include "platform/syslog.h"
#include "include/dart_api.h"

Go to the source code of this file.

Namespaces

namespace  dart
 
namespace  dart::bin
 

Functions

static char ** dart::bin::ExtractCStringList (Dart_Handle strings, Dart_Handle status_handle, const char *error_msg, intptr_t *length)
 
void FUNCTION_NAME() dart::bin::Process_Start (Dart_NativeArguments args)
 
void FUNCTION_NAME() dart::bin::Process_Wait (Dart_NativeArguments args)
 
void FUNCTION_NAME() dart::bin::Process_KillPid (Dart_NativeArguments args)
 
void FUNCTION_NAME() dart::bin::Process_Exit (Dart_NativeArguments args)
 
void FUNCTION_NAME() dart::bin::Process_SetExitCode (Dart_NativeArguments args)
 
void FUNCTION_NAME() dart::bin::Process_GetExitCode (Dart_NativeArguments args)
 
void FUNCTION_NAME() dart::bin::Process_Sleep (Dart_NativeArguments args)
 
void FUNCTION_NAME() dart::bin::Process_Pid (Dart_NativeArguments args)
 
void FUNCTION_NAME() dart::bin::Process_SetSignalHandler (Dart_NativeArguments args)
 
void FUNCTION_NAME() dart::bin::Process_ClearSignalHandler (Dart_NativeArguments args)
 
void FUNCTION_NAME() dart::bin::SystemEncodingToString (Dart_NativeArguments args)
 
void FUNCTION_NAME() dart::bin::StringToSystemEncoding (Dart_NativeArguments args)
 
void FUNCTION_NAME() dart::bin::ProcessInfo_CurrentRSS (Dart_NativeArguments args)
 
void FUNCTION_NAME() dart::bin::ProcessInfo_MaxRSS (Dart_NativeArguments args)
 

Variables

static constexpr int dart::bin::kProcessIdNativeField = 0